So, I had an idea today, and it kind of blew up on my ride into work.

Bedsheets.

Bedsheets.

These are the most under-utilized, under-used item on the station, you can wear them as a cape, or put them on a bed. This would overhaul that.

Construction: - One bedsheet, use to bring up the construction menu like when you use a metal sheet.

Improvised Backpack: - Use one bed sheet to make an improvised four slot bag that you can wear on your back. The color of the bag depends on the color/style of the sheets.

Bindle - Construct on a table with an improvised backpack, a metal rod and cable coil. Sprite looks like a hobo's bag. Doesn't add any slots, but when you hit someone with it with help intent, it has a 30% chance of giving them a two tick stun, like a small banana peel. Does no damage when used with harm intent UNLESS there's a sandstone brick, sandbag, or metal ingot in it.

Cloak - Two sheets on a table via construction. Creates an exo-worn white cloak that has no defense bonus, but can be dyed in the wash with a crayon.

Bath Robe - Two sheets on a table via construction. Creates an exo-worn white bath robe with no defense bonus, but can be dyed with the wash and a crayon.

Luxury Bath Robe - Use a bath robe, three coins of any type, and a cable coil to create a luxury bath robe with a small defense bonus, but looks fly as hell. Can be dyed in the wash with a crayon.

Tear - Creates three small cloth pieces per sheet.

Cloth Pieces - Use to create a number of items:

Improvised Gag - Two cloth pieces. When worn on the mouth, it allows the person to still talk, but their words are muffled like when someone whispers. Can not speak over the radio with it on.

Improvised Blindfold - Two cloth pieces. When worn on the eyes, the wearer gets the 'whited out' filter on that people near death get in crit.

Improvised Bonds - Two cloth pieces. Can be used like cuffs, but only have a 20 second breakout time.

Hood - Uses three cloth pieces, creates a white cloth hood worn on the head. Has no functional defense, but can be dyed with a crayon in the washers.

Sling - Three cloth pieces and a grenade casing. When thrown, it knocks down the victim for 2 seconds, and does some brute damage. If there's an actual grenade in it, instead of an empty casing, it will go off when it impacts, with the full timer, giving the victim a chance to get away--but less of a chance. Unlike bolos, they don't attach to the legs.

Pneumatic Cannon Sling - Six cloth pieces and a phneumatic cannon. The cannon goes off on impact, filling the area it lands on (and the people it lands on) with shrapnel.

Stocking:

Use bedsheets on the clothing dispenser to re-stock taken clothing items, like filling an Autolathe.

Getting More Cloth:

Cotton - The botanists will be able to grow cotton seeds which can be processed into sheets.

Wool - Goats ordered from Cargo will be able to be sheared with a shaver or any array of bladed implements (on help intent), to produce wool which can be used to create gray bed sheets. Goats will re-grow their coat every 10 minutes or so. Pete will produce blood red wool, the color of a syndie hardsuit.

Fur - Poor Ian can be shaved to produce a corgi colored sheet. Ian's fur does not re-grow, but a sheet can be used on Ian to make him an improvised jacket.
